Print Upmop 4 is a regular weight, narrow, medium cont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

A casual hand-drawn print with rounded terminals and softly irregular stroke edges that mimic marker or brush-pen pressure. Forms are generally narrow with open counters and simplified construction, keeping a steady rhythm while allowing small variations in curves and joins. Capitals are clean and upright with gently uneven bowls and arms; lowercase maintains a compact, readable skeleton with a single-storey “a” and “g,” and a lightly curved “t” and “f.” Numerals follow the same friendly, rounded treatment, with clear shapes and minimal sharp corners.
Well suited for children’s materials, casual posters, greeting cards, and packaging that benefits from a friendly, hand-made voice. It also works for short UI labels, social graphics, and small blocks of display text where warmth and approachability matter more than strict uniformity.
The overall tone is warm and informal, with a lighthearted, handwritten charm. Its slightly bouncy irregularities feel personable and conversational rather than precise or technical.
Likely designed to provide an easygoing handwritten print style that stays readable while retaining the natural variation of hand lettering. The goal appears to be a versatile, friendly display face for informal communication and playful branding.
Spacing appears moderately loose and consistent in text, helping the narrow letterforms stay legible. The stroke modulation is subtle, and the rounded corners and softened joins reduce visual tension, supporting a relaxed, everyday feel.
